Neurizon's NUZ-001 Demonstrates Neuroprotective Effects in Huntington's Disease Zebrafish Model
- NUZ-001 and its active metabolite NUZ-001 Sulfone showed significant neuroprotective effects in a zebrafish model of Huntington's disease, preventing developmental abnormalities and neuronal cell death.
- Treatment with both compounds rescued key biomarkers including BDNF expression and haemoglobin production following huntingtin protein knockdown in the disease model.
- The findings strengthen NUZ-001's potential as a platform therapy for multiple neurodegenerative diseases beyond its current ALS development program.
- Neurizon plans to advance additional preclinical studies in mammalian models of Huntington's disease to further validate the therapeutic potential.
